Abstract:
The present inventors discovered that PKCε is necessary for VEGF signaling through PI3K/Akt-dependent pathways and is involved in MAPK-dependent pathways, thus regulating eNOS activity and DNA synthesis, respectively. Thus differential manipulation of PKCε activity can be used to modify VEGF effects in conditions in which modulation of angiogenesis is desirable (e.g., for treatment of diabetic proliferative retinopathy or to enhance angiogenesis for treatment of peripheral and myocardial ischemia).
